SUMMARY
The reloading of screen configuration is very slow. I have an USB-C dock with
two connected screens. Removing one of the screens (e.g. by switch off) reloads
the one screen config, however the reload process takes about 17sec, which is
very slow. Switching back the second screen it also takes about the same time
to reload the two screen config. During the reload the non-removed (constantly
present through the process) screen is also seems to be disconnected totally
(the monitor reports no signal) which seems to be absolutely unnecessary. 

OBSERVED RESULT
Very slow reload of screen config and the non removed screen is also fully
disconnected during the reload process.

EXPECTED RESULT
A fast switch where the not affected screen is not disconnected only the
desktop arrangement changes, like with Windows.

S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S
Operating System: openSUSE Tumbleweed 20260329
KDE Plasma Version: 6.6.3
KDE Frameworks Version: 6.24.0
Qt Version: 6.11.0
Kernel Version: 6.19.10-1-default (64-bit)
Graphics Platform: X11
